tongue

tongue

 
 
pronunciation:
tuhng
parts of speech:
noun, transitive verb, intransitive verb
features:
Word Combinations (noun), Word Explorer
part of speech: noun
definition 1: the fleshy, movable organ in the bottom of the mouth, used for licking, tasting, swallowing, and human speech.
 
definition 2: such an organ taken from a cow, ox, or other animal and used as food.
similar words:
meat
definition 3: something resembling such an organ in form or function.
synonyms:
flap
similar words:
lap, ligule
definition 4: power or manner of speaking.
a harsh tongue
synonyms:
language, locution, parlance, speech, talk
similar words:
diction, expression, phrasing, style, wording
definition 5: the language or dialect of a particular area.
She spoke in a foreign tongue.
synonyms:
dialect, language, speech
similar words:
lingo, patois, vernacular
definition 6: a flap of leather under the laces of a shoe or boot.
similar words:
flap

part of speech: transitive verb
inflections: tongues, tonguing, tongued
definition 1: to articulate (notes played on a wind instrument) by moving the tongue in short strokes.
definition 2: to lick or touch with or as if with the tongue.
synonyms:
lap up, lick
similar words:
suck
 
part of speech: intransitive verb
definition 1: to articulate notes played on a wind instrument by moving the tongue in short strokes.
definition 2: to project or stick out.
synonyms:
jut out, project, protrude, stick out
similar words:
poke
derivations: tongueless (adj.), tonguelike (adj.)
